I had a few minutes this morning before work and had to share my favorite snack find. Let me start off by saying I love peanut butter. I like almond butter, but I LOVE peanut butter. As you know peanut butter also comes with a lot of calories, not the best to devour while trying to shed a few pounds (just ask my scale). And sure you can have a serving size, but who really has a serving size of the deliciousness. Then some genius came out with PB2. 

Powdered Peanut butter for snacks
Looks so simple,
yet so much deliciousness in a powder and less calories!

PB2 is powdered peanut butter and according to the label 85% less fat and calories than traditional peanut butter. You just mix the powder with liquid and voila peanut butter. Okay, sure it's not exactly like eating from a jar of the real deal, but it definitely helps to satisfy my peanut butter craving. I have also started using it in my morning shakes...chocolate, banana, and PB2...hello happy taste buds!!! 

I know there are lots of brands out there now, but I noticed some other brands have added "stuff" to them. No thank you. I love having a little bowl at night while watching tv or during the day with a cut up apple.
